Analysis
The most recent figure for industry (including construction), value added (constant 2015 us$) in Fiji is 38,334 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re, measured in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 0.2% on the previous year and up 20.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, industry (including construction), value added (constant 2015 us$) in Fiji peaked at 45,838 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re in 2018 and was at its lowest, 9,039 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re, in 1965.
Fiji ranks 134th of 193 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 59 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ated
Industry (including construction), value added (constant 2015 US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Industry (including construction), value added (constant 2015 US$)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
Computed from
- Industry (including construction), value added Country official statistics, National Statistical Offices (NSOs)
- Land area FAOSTAT,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(FAO)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
